.hero-canvas[data-astro-cid-bbe6dxrz]{opacity:0;transition:opacity .8s ease}.hero-canvas[data-astro-cid-bbe6dxrz].is-ready{opacity:1}.why-principle[data-astro-cid-ygbk6wav]{transition:background-color .22s ease,transform .22s ease}.why-principle[data-astro-cid-ygbk6wav]:hover{background:var(--color-brand-cream-light);transform:translateY(-1px)}.why-index[data-astro-cid-ygbk6wav]{transition:transform .22s ease,opacity .22s ease}.why-marker[data-astro-cid-ygbk6wav]{transition:transform .22s ease,background-color .22s ease}.why-principle[data-astro-cid-ygbk6wav]:hover .why-index[data-astro-cid-ygbk6wav]{transform:translate(2px)}.why-principle[data-astro-cid-ygbk6wav]:hover .why-marker[data-astro-cid-ygbk6wav]{transform:scale(1.15);background:var(--color-brand-gold)}@media(prefers-reduced-motion:reduce){.why-principle[data-astro-cid-ygbk6wav],.why-index[data-astro-cid-ygbk6wav],.why-marker[data-astro-cid-ygbk6wav]{transition:none!important}.why-principle[data-astro-cid-ygbk6wav]:hover,.why-principle[data-astro-cid-ygbk6wav]:hover .why-index[data-astro-cid-ygbk6wav],.why-principle[data-astro-cid-ygbk6wav]:hover .why-marker[data-astro-cid-ygbk6wav]{transform:none}}@property --shine{syntax: "<angle>"; initial-value: 210deg; inherits: false;}@property --n{syntax: "<integer>"; initial-value: 0; inherits: true;}@property --tilt-x{syntax: "<angle>"; initial-value: 0deg; inherits: false;}@property --tilt-y{syntax: "<angle>"; initial-value: 0deg; inherits: false;}.nn-section[data-astro-cid-2y5a4jeg]{perspective:1600px}.nn-grain[data-astro-cid-2y5a4jeg]{position:absolute;inset:0;opacity:.35;mix-blend-mode:overlay;pointer-events:none;background-image:radial-gradient(rgba(255,255,255,.04) 1px,transparent 1px),radial-gradient(rgba(0,0,0,.18) 1px,transparent 1px);background-size:3px 3px,5px 5px;background-position:0 0,1px 1px}.nn-glow[data-astro-cid-2y5a4jeg]{position:absolute;left:50%;top:55%;width:1650px;height:1650px;transform:translate(-50%,-50%);background:radial-gradient(closest-side,rgba(196,162,101,.22),rgba(196,162,101,.08) 45%,transparent 72%);pointer-events:none;filter:blur(18px)}.nn-slab[data-astro-cid-2y5a4jeg]{position:relative;transform-style:preserve-3d;transition:transform .4s cubic-bezier(.22,1,.36,1)}.nn-slab-inner[data-astro-cid-2y5a4jeg]{position:relative;height:100%;min-height:520px;padding:2px;border-radius:var(--radius-card);background:linear-gradient(155deg,#c4a2658c,#c4a26514 40%,#ffffff05 70%,#c4a2654d);transform:rotateX(var(--tilt-x, 0deg)) rotateY(var(--tilt-y, 0deg));transform-style:preserve-3d;transition:transform .45s cubic-bezier(.22,1,.36,1),box-shadow .45s ease;box-shadow:0 20px 40px -20px #0009,0 2px #ffffff08 inset}.nn-slab[data-astro-cid-2y5a4jeg]:hover .nn-slab-inner[data-astro-cid-2y5a4jeg]{box-shadow:0 40px 80px -20px #000000bf,0 0 0 1px #c4a26559 inset}.nn-content[data-astro-cid-2y5a4jeg]{position:relative;height:100%;border-radius:calc(var(--radius-card) - 2px);background:linear-gradient(180deg,#1a1a18,#111110);padding:40px 36px 36px;display:flex;flex-direction:column;overflow:hidden;isolation:isolate}.nn-foil[data-astro-cid-2y5a4jeg]{position:absolute;inset:-2px;border-radius:var(--radius-card);pointer-events:none;z-index:0;background:conic-gradient(from var(--shine),transparent 0deg,transparent 160deg,rgba(212,184,122,0) 170deg,rgba(232,208,155,.55) 185deg,rgba(255,236,190,.85) 195deg,rgba(232,208,155,.55) 205deg,transparent 220deg,transparent 360deg);mix-blend-mode:screen;opacity:0;transition:opacity .5s ease;filter:blur(8px)}.nn-slab[data-astro-cid-2y5a4jeg]:hover .nn-foil[data-astro-cid-2y5a4jeg]{opacity:.9;animation:nn-shine 2.4s cubic-bezier(.22,1,.36,1) forwards}@keyframes nn-shine{0%{--shine: 210deg}to{--shine: 570deg}}.nn-frame[data-astro-cid-2y5a4jeg]{position:absolute;inset:10px;border-radius:calc(var(--radius-card) - 6px);border:1px solid rgba(196,162,101,.22);pointer-events:none;z-index:1;transform:translateZ(20px)}.nn-num[data-astro-cid-2y5a4jeg]{--n: 0;counter-reset:n var(--n);font-family:var(--font-headings);font-weight:700;font-size:clamp(120px,13vw,200px);line-height:1.05;letter-spacing:-.04em;padding-bottom:.08em;background:linear-gradient(180deg,#e8d09b,#c4a265 55%,#8a6d3e);-webkit-background-clip:text;background-clip:text;color:transparent;transform:translateZ(40px);text-shadow:0 0 40px rgba(196,162,101,.15)}.nn-num[data-astro-cid-2y5a4jeg]:after{content:counter(n)}.nn-slab[data-astro-cid-2y5a4jeg].is-visible .nn-num[data-astro-cid-2y5a4jeg]{animation:nn-count 1.4s cubic-bezier(.22,1,.36,1) forwards;animation-delay:calc(var(--i) * .18s + .2s)}@keyframes nn-count{0%{--n: 0}to{--n: var(--n-target)}}.nn-icon[data-astro-cid-2y5a4jeg]{color:var(--color-brand-gold);width:48px;height:48px;opacity:.85;transform:translateZ(30px)}.nn-icon[data-astro-cid-2y5a4jeg] svg[data-astro-cid-2y5a4jeg]{width:100%;height:100%}.nn-stroke[data-astro-cid-2y5a4jeg]{stroke-dasharray:260;stroke-dashoffset:260}.nn-slab[data-astro-cid-2y5a4jeg].is-visible .nn-stroke[data-astro-cid-2y5a4jeg]{animation:nn-draw 1.6s cubic-bezier(.65,0,.35,1) forwards;animation-delay:calc(var(--i) * .18s + .4s)}@keyframes nn-draw{to{stroke-dashoffset:0}}.nn-title[data-astro-cid-2y5a4jeg]{font-family:var(--font-headings);font-size:34px;font-weight:700;color:var(--color-brand-cream);margin-bottom:20px;transform:translateZ(25px)}.nn-body[data-astro-cid-2y5a4jeg]{font-family:var(--font-body);font-size:15.5px;line-height:1.7;color:#e8e6dcb8;max-width:none;transform:translateZ(15px);flex:1}.nn-rule[data-astro-cid-2y5a4jeg]{margin-top:28px;height:1px;background:linear-gradient(90deg,transparent,rgba(196,162,101,.5),transparent);transform:scaleX(0);transform-origin:left;transition:transform .8s cubic-bezier(.22,1,.36,1)}.nn-slab[data-astro-cid-2y5a4jeg]:hover .nn-rule[data-astro-cid-2y5a4jeg]{transform:scaleX(1)}.nn-cta[data-astro-cid-2y5a4jeg]{position:relative;z-index:3;cursor:pointer;display:inline-flex;align-items:center;gap:8px;margin-top:20px;color:var(--color-brand-gold);font-family:var(--font-body);font-size:13px;font-weight:600;letter-spacing:.04em;text-decoration:none;transform:translateZ(20px);transition:gap .3s cubic-bezier(.22,1,.36,1),color .3s ease;width:fit-content}.nn-cta[data-astro-cid-2y5a4jeg] svg[data-astro-cid-2y5a4jeg]{width:16px;height:16px;transition:transform .3s cubic-bezier(.22,1,.36,1)}.nn-cta[data-astro-cid-2y5a4jeg]:hover{gap:12px;color:#e8d09b}.nn-cta[data-astro-cid-2y5a4jeg]:hover svg[data-astro-cid-2y5a4jeg]{transform:translate(2px)}.nn-cta[data-astro-cid-2y5a4jeg]:focus-visible{outline:2px solid rgba(196,162,101,.55);outline-offset:4px;border-radius:4px}@media(prefers-reduced-motion:reduce){.nn-slab-inner[data-astro-cid-2y5a4jeg]{transition:none;transform:none!important}.nn-foil[data-astro-cid-2y5a4jeg]{display:none}.nn-slab[data-astro-cid-2y5a4jeg][data-num="1"] .nn-num[data-astro-cid-2y5a4jeg]:after{content:"1"}.nn-slab[data-astro-cid-2y5a4jeg][data-num="2"] .nn-num[data-astro-cid-2y5a4jeg]:after{content:"2"}.nn-slab[data-astro-cid-2y5a4jeg][data-num="3"] .nn-num[data-astro-cid-2y5a4jeg]:after{content:"3"}.nn-slab[data-astro-cid-2y5a4jeg].is-visible .nn-num[data-astro-cid-2y5a4jeg],.nn-slab[data-astro-cid-2y5a4jeg].is-visible .nn-stroke[data-astro-cid-2y5a4jeg]{animation:none}.nn-stroke[data-astro-cid-2y5a4jeg]{stroke-dashoffset:0}}@media(max-width:768px){.nn-slab-inner[data-astro-cid-2y5a4jeg]{min-height:440px;transform:none!important}.nn-content[data-astro-cid-2y5a4jeg]{padding:32px 28px}}.method-card[data-astro-cid-trd3xztu]{background:#fff;border:1px solid var(--color-brand-border);border-radius:var(--radius-card);padding:24px 26px;box-shadow:var(--shadow-card)}.method-card-top[data-astro-cid-trd3xztu]{display:flex;align-items:flex-start;justify-content:space-between;gap:16px;padding-bottom:18px;margin-bottom:18px;border-bottom:1px solid var(--color-brand-border)}.method-card-meta[data-astro-cid-trd3xztu]{display:grid;gap:8px}.method-card-label[data-astro-cid-trd3xztu]{font-family:var(--font-body);font-size:10px;font-weight:600;letter-spacing:.18em;text-transform:uppercase;color:var(--color-brand-dark-light)}.method-card-badge[data-astro-cid-trd3xztu]{display:inline-flex;align-items:center;justify-content:center;width:fit-content;padding:5px 10px;border-radius:999px;background:#c4a2651f;color:var(--color-brand-gold-dark);font-family:var(--font-body);font-size:10px;font-weight:700;letter-spacing:.16em;text-transform:uppercase}.method-toggle[data-astro-cid-trd3xztu]{display:inline-gr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:4px;padding:4px;border-radius:999px;border:1px solid var(--color-brand-border);background:var(--color-brand-cream-light)}.method-tab[data-astro-cid-trd3xztu]{appearance:none;border:0;background:transparent;border-radius:999px;padding:8px 14px;font-family:var(--font-body);font-size:11px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--color-brand-dark-light);cursor:pointer;transition:background-color .18s ease,color .18s ease,transform .18s ease}.method-tab[data-astro-cid-trd3xztu]:hover,.method-tab[data-astro-cid-trd3xztu]:focus-visible{color:var(--color-brand-dark)}.method-tab[data-astro-cid-trd3xztu]:focus-visible{outline:2px solid rgba(196,162,101,.45);outline-offset:2px}.method-tab[data-astro-cid-trd3xztu].is-active{background:var(--color-brand-dark);color:var(--color-brand-cream-light);transform:translateY(-1px)}.method-panel-frame[data-astro-cid-trd3xztu]{margin-bottom:0}.method-panel[data-astro-cid-trd3xztu][hidden]{display:none}.method-state-eyebrow[data-astro-cid-trd3xztu]{display:inline-flex;align-items:center;gap:8px;width:fit-content;padding:6px 12px;border-radius:999px;background:#c4a2651a;color:var(--color-brand-gold-dark);font-family:var(--font-body);font-size:10px;font-weight:700;letter-spacing:.08em;text-transform:uppercase;line-height:1.4}.method-panel[data-astro-cid-trd3xztu] h4[data-astro-cid-trd3xztu]{margin:14px 0;font-family:var(--font-headings);font-size:30px;line-height:1.12;letter-spacing:-.02em;color:var(--color-brand-dark);max-width:none}.method-points[data-astro-cid-trd3xztu]{list-style:none;padding:0;margin:0}.method-point[data-astro-cid-trd3xztu]{display:flex;align-items:flex-start;gap:12px;padding:11px 0;border-top:1px solid rgba(213,211,200,.75);color:var(--color-brand-dark-light);font-family:var(--font-body);font-size:14px;line-height:1.6}.method-point[data-astro-cid-trd3xztu]:first-child{border-top:0}.method-point-dot[data-astro-cid-trd3xztu]{width:7px;height:7px;margin-top:.6rem;border-radius:999px;background:var(--color-brand-gold);flex-shrink:0}@media(max-width:768px){.method-card[data-astro-cid-trd3xztu]{padding:20px 18px}.method-card-top[data-astro-cid-trd3xztu]{flex-direction:column;align-items:stretch}.method-toggle[data-astro-cid-trd3xztu]{width:100%}.method-tab[data-astro-cid-trd3xztu]{justify-content:center}.method-panel[data-astro-cid-trd3xztu] h4[data-astro-cid-trd3xztu]{font-size:26px;max-width:none}}@media(prefers-reduced-motion:reduce){.method-tab[data-astro-cid-trd3xztu]{transition:none}}.cs-card-wrap[data-astro-cid-2urjykrc]{perspective:1100px}.reveal[data-astro-cid-2urjykrc].cs-card-wrap{transition-delay:calc(var(--i) * 90ms)}.cs-card[data-astro-cid-2urjykrc]{transform:rotateX(var(--tilt-x, 0deg)) rotateY(var(--tilt-y, 0deg)) translateY(var(--lift, 0px));transition:transform .2s cubic-bezier(.22,1,.36,1),box-shadow .28s ease,border-color .28s ease;will-change:transform}.cs-card[data-astro-cid-2urjykrc]:hover{--lift: -6px;box-shadow:var(--shadow-card-hover),0 0 0 1px #c4a26566;border-color:#c4a2658c}.cs-num[data-astro-cid-2urjykrc]{font-variant-numeric:tabular-nums}.cs-meter-track[data-astro-cid-2urjykrc]{background:#1414130f}.cs-meter-bar[data-astro-cid-2urjykrc]{width:var(--w);background:var(--color-brand-gold)}.js[data-astro-cid-2urjykrc] .cs-meter-bar[data-astro-cid-2urjykrc]{width:0}.js[data-astro-cid-2urjykrc] .cs-meter-bar[data-astro-cid-2urjykrc]{transition:width 1s cubic-bezier(.22,1,.36,1);transition-delay:calc(var(--i) * .11s + .3s)}.js[data-astro-cid-2urjykrc] .cs-card-wrap[data-astro-cid-2urjykrc].is-visible .cs-meter-bar[data-astro-cid-2urjykrc]{width:var(--w)}@media(prefers-reduced-motion:reduce){.cs-card[data-astro-cid-2urjykrc]{transition:none;transform:none}.js[data-astro-cid-2urjykrc] .cs-meter-bar[data-astro-cid-2urjykrc]{width:var(--w);transition:none}}.cs-portrait[data-astro-cid-kaxhozih]{position:absolute;top:1.75rem;right:1.75rem;width:128px;height:128px;border-radius:9999px;overflow:hidden;z-index:1;box-shadow:0 10px 30px #1414132e,inset 0 0 0 1px #fff9;transform:translateZ(0);transition:transform .5s cubic-bezier(.2,.8,.2,1),box-shadow .5s ease}.cs-portrait[data-astro-cid-kaxhozih] img[data-astro-cid-kaxhozih]{width:100%;height:100%;object-fit:cover;display:block;filter:saturate(.95);transition:filter .5s ease,transform .8s cubic-bezier(.2,.8,.2,1)}.cs-portrait-ring[data-astro-cid-kaxhozih]{position:absolute;inset:-6px;border-radius:9999px;border:1.5px solid rgba(196,162,101,.45);pointer-events:none;transition:inset .45s ease,border-color .45s ease,opacity .45s ease}.cs-card[data-astro-cid-kaxhozih]:hover .cs-portrait[data-astro-cid-kaxhozih]{transform:translateY(-2px) scale(1.03);box-shadow:0 16px 40px #14141338,inset 0 0 0 1px #fff9}.cs-card[data-astro-cid-kaxhozih]:hover .cs-portrait[data-astro-cid-kaxhozih] img[data-astro-cid-kaxhozih]{filter:saturate(1.05);transform:scale(1.04)}.cs-card[data-astro-cid-kaxhozih]:hover .cs-portrait-ring[data-astro-cid-kaxhozih]{inset:-10px;border-color:#c4a265cc}@media(min-width:768px){.cs-portrait[data-astro-cid-kaxhozih]{width:140px;height:140px;top:2rem;right:2rem}}.cs-sig[data-astro-cid-kaxhozih]{position:absolute;right:1.75rem;bottom:1.5rem;color:var(--color-brand-dark);opacity:.85;pointer-events:none;z-index:1}.cs-sig[data-astro-cid-kaxhozih] svg[data-astro-cid-kaxhozih]{display:block;overflow:visible;max-width:100%}.cs-sig-path[data-astro-cid-kaxhozih]{stroke-dasharray:1;stroke-dashoffset:1}@keyframes cs-draw{to{stroke-dashoffset:0}}.cs-card[data-astro-cid-kaxhozih].is-signed .cs-sig-path[data-astro-cid-kaxhozih]{animation-name:cs-draw;animation-duration:var(--sig-dur, 3.4s);animation-delay:var(--sig-delay, .2s);animation-timing-function:cubic-bezier(.5,.1,.3,1);animation-fill-mode:forwards}@media(min-width:1024px){.cs-sig[data-astro-cid-kaxhozih]{right:2rem;bottom:1.75rem}}@media(prefers-reduced-motion:reduce){.cs-portrait[data-astro-cid-kaxhozih],.cs-portrait[data-astro-cid-kaxhozih] img[data-astro-cid-kaxhozih],.cs-portrait-ring[data-astro-cid-kaxhozih]{transition:none!important}.cs-sig-path[data-astro-cid-kaxhozih]{animation:none!important;stroke-dashoffset:0!important}}
